Law & AI – A Webinar with ADM Computing & Cripps Solicitors

Event Details

Join us for an enlightening webinar, “Law & AI” brought to you through a unique collaboration between ADM Computing and Cripps Solicitors. This event aims to bridge the gap between technological innovation and legal frameworks, focusing on the implications of Artificial Intelligence both in the workplace and in the legal domain.

As AI technologies continue to advance, their integration into various sectors poses both opportunities and challenges, particularly in legal contexts. This webinar offers a dual perspective, combining legal expertise with technical insights to explore how AI is reshaping the landscape of law, from compliance and ethics to automation and beyond.

What Will Be Covered?

Understanding AI: An introduction to how AI is currently used and utilised with examples of popular AI tools.

Future Trends in AI: Insights into upcoming innovations and how your business can prepare for the future impact of AI.

Legal Challenges and AI: Discussion of the regulatory landscape for AI, focusing on privacy, intellectual property, and liability issues.

Ethical Considerations in AI: Explore the ethical dimensions of AI development and deployment, including bias, transparency, and accountability.
